>The Empty Bottle is pleased to welcome shimmering German electronic
>producer ULRICH SCHNAUSS to the open-end. SCHNAUSS has garnered much
>acclaim for the two albums he's released thus far - Far Away Trains Passing
>By and A Strangely Isolated Place, respectively - and he's purportedly got
>a new longplayer in the works now as we speak. This performance will mark
>his Chicago debut, after an injury sustained in New York last year forced
>the cancellation of a scheduled gig here in September. New Carpark artist
>MONTAG will also be making his Chicago debut, playing in support of Alone,
>Not Alone, a near-faultless effort that features guest contributions from
>the likes of BROADCAST, BROKEN SOCIAL SCENE, SIXTOO and STARS. Electronic
>producer and trained pianist KATE SIMKO will open, playing minimalist
>click-clackeries of subtle, supple sophistication. As with all shows at the
>intimate open-end space, tickets will be limited and we encourage that they
>be purchased in advance. The event will take place as a part of the Tragic
>Beauty art installation, and shouldn't be missed.

>Another strong entry in a month long series of free shows, this particular
>engagement will feature eccentric multi-instrumental project FOG. What
>began as an experiment in, well, experimental hip hop has now evolved into
>an abstracted perversion of a variety of genre elements, a freewheeling
>grab of all things interesting. For this, FOG will be celebrating the
>release of a new Lex longplayer 10th Avenue Freakout. Electronic composer
>CEPIA will open, a polyglot producer that references only the most
>affecting elements of pop, rock and jazz. He's recently issued his debut,
>The Dowry, on the regarded Ghostly International imprint.
